
Sam Bankman-Fried Arrested, Charged in the U.S.
The former FTX CEO is facing criminal and civil charges.

Sam Bankman-Fried (SBF), co-founder and former CEO of the bankrupt crypto exchange FTX, has been arrested in the Bahamas after U.S. federal prosecutors and regulators filed criminal and civil charges respectively against him. The charges were unsealed on the same day SBF was expected to testify in Congress as hearings about FTX's collapse begin. Ram Ahluwalia, the CEO and co-founder of Lumida Wealth Management, joins Nico Brugge and Ash Bennington to discuss.
